act curtain
Theater. a curtain for closing the proscenium opening between acts or scenes. -
backstage
In a theatre, backstage refers to the areas behind the stage. -
forestage
the part of a stage in front of the proscenium or the closed curtain, as the apron or an extension of the apron. -
grand drapery
a valance across the proscenium arch, forming part of the decorative frame for the stage. -

safety curtain
a sheet of asbestos or other fireproof material that can be lowered just inside the proscenium arch in case of fire, sealing off the backstage area from the auditorium.
